Office building with production hall
Břečka, Jan ; Balázs, Ivan (referee) ; Horáček, Martin (advisor)
The aim of this diploma´s thesis is to design steel-concrete structure of the office building and steel structure of production hall situated in Moravské Budějovice. The dimensions of the office building are 48,0 x 60,0 meters and height is 17,0 meters. The main constructional material is S 255 steel and C30/37 concrete. The load bearing structure of the hall consists of the columns, primary and secondary beams. The axial distance of columns is 6 meters (5 meters). The dimensions of the production hall are 24,0 x 60,0 meters and height is 12,0 meters. Inside the production hall is craneway. An analysis of two solutions of the supporting structure was performed. The first variant is consists of rigid frames. Truss girder in the second variant is an alternative solution. Both variants were compared and the amount of steel was found. The selected option was developed in greater details with static calculation, drawings and material report. The static analysis of the main load bearing parts of the structure is processed. The calcuation were made in accordance with the European design codes.

Production of the screw
Starý, Petr ; Podaný, Kamil (referee) ; Císařová, Michaela (advisor)
The bachelor´s degree project deals with the production of rotating component using cold forming technology. There are described basic principles of technology, used material, tools and machines and the area of usage. Production of the screw is based on the literary studies and technical calculations. The suggested manufacturing variant consists of five steps and containing cutting, extrusion and upsetting. As raw material was chosen a wire with diameter of 12,5 mm and length of 38,6 mm made of steel 12040. For chosen variant was made technological and strength calculations for the individual operations.
Design of facility for egg-shells transportation
Hruška, Kryštof ; Naď, Martin (referee) ; Pernica, Marek (advisor)
Egg shells are a very suitable basic raw material for the production of mineral dietary supplements. The thesis deals with one of the processes in their production, the transportation of the commodity after flush into a clean room. The thesis proposes possible solutions, which are described in the research part, on the basis of which a screw conveyor is chosen as a suitable solution and a design solution is proposed. Based on the calculations, the individual parts of the conveyor are selected and designed. The entire device is modeled in SolidWorks and the drawing documentation contains the overall drawing of the assembly.

Timber foot bridge over a wolf run
Mynaříková, Alice ; Šmak, Milan (referee) ; Straka, Bohumil (advisor)
The subject of this diploma thesis is the construction of a timber foot bridge over the wolf run in the Šumava National Park. The total length of the bridge is 240 m with two ground plan bends. The foot bridge includes three viewing decks, two of which are covered with shed roofs. The foot bridge is divided into 16 segments. Each segment is 15 m long with a width of 2.2 meters. The ground plan dimensions of the viewing decks are approximately 15x7 and 15x11 m. As the main structural material has been chosen glued laminated timber of the strength class GL28h, other elements are made of solid timber of the strength class C24. The thesis includes an introductory document, options analysis, technical report, static analysis, bill of material and drawings.
